Perplexity has secured $200 million in new funding at a $20 billion valuation, marking a rapid increase from its $18 billion valuation just two months ago and bringing its total funding raised to $1.5 billion since its founding three years ago[1]. The company’s annual recurring revenue is reported to be approaching $200 million, reflecting strong growth as it positions itself as a challenger to Google’s search dominance[1]. Additionally, Perplexity made headlines last month by offering $34.5 billion to acquire Google’s Chrome browser, following antitrust pressure on Google, though a recent court ruling allowed Google to keep Chrome[1].

Perplexity’s latest $200 million funding round at a $20 billion valuation significantly shakes up the AI search competitive landscape, intensifying pressure on incumbents like Google, which has responded by expanding its AI Overview in search results[1][3]. Perplexity’s move into the browser market with its AI-powered Comet browser and its $34.5 billion bid to acquire Google Chrome directly challenges Google’s search dominance amid ongoing antitrust scrutiny[1][3]. This rapid valuation jump from $14 billion in May to $20 billion highlights Perplexity’s accelerating growth and positions it as a formidable competitor to Google, OpenAI, and others racing to innovate in AI search[1][3].
